About the Artist
Félix Edouard Vallotton · 1865–1925
Félix Edouard Vallotton (1865–1925) was a Swiss-French painter and printmaker whose deceptively spare imagery concealed a penetrating psychological acuity and a gift for formal invention. Born in Lausanne, Switzerland, he moved to Paris at the age of seventeen to study at the prestigious École des Beaux-Arts, quickly immersing himself in the city's vital avant-garde scene.
